sumproduct函数的使用方法及实例适合新手吗?
是的,SUMPRODUCT函数非常适合新手入门与进阶使用。它语法简洁、无需数组三键组合,仅用标准回车即可执行;基础形式如=SUMPRODUCT(A2:A10,B2:B10)就能完成逐项相乘求和,直观易懂;更可自然融入逻辑判断,例如=(A2:A10="华为")*C2:C10,将TRUE/FALSE自动转为1/0参与运算,实现单条件求和;配合MONTH、FIND、ISNUMBER等函数,还能轻松处理按月份汇总、模糊匹配、文本数字混合等真实办公场景。权威Excel技术文档与微软官方学习中心均指出,该函数在兼容性、稳定性及功能密度上表现均衡,被广泛应用于财务统计、销售分析与行政报表等日常任务中,是提升数据处理效率的实用利器。
一、新手入门的三步实操路径
首先,从最基础的数值相乘求和开始:在空白单元格输入=SUMPRODUCT(A2:A8,B2:B8),确保两列数据均为纯数字且行数一致(如均为7行),按回车即可得到A列与B列对应位置乘积之和。第二步,过渡到单条件求和:假设A列为产品名称、C列为销量,需统计“华为”产品的总销量,输入=SUMPRODUCT((A2:A13="华为")*C2:C13),注意括号必须成对,逻辑判断部分用英文双引号包裹文本。第三步,尝试多条件叠加:例如统计“华为”且“手机”类别的销售额,公式为=SUMPRODUCT((A2:A13="华为")*(B2:B13="手机")*D2:D13),此时两个条件之间用英文星号连接,代表逻辑“与”,系统自动将TRUE×TRUE转为1,其余组合转为0,再与数值列相乘累加。
二、避开新手高频错误的关键细节
务必保证所有参与运算的数组维度完全相同,例如A2:A10与C2:C12长度不一致会导致#VALUE!错误;若数据区域含空单元格或文本型数字(如带空格的“123 ”),SUMPRODUCT会将其视作0,导致结果偏低,建议先用TRIM与VALUE函数清洗;使用通配符模糊匹配时,不可直接写“*华为*”,而应配合FIND函数构建布尔数组,如ISNUMBER(FIND("华为",B2:B10)),再与数值列相乘;当条件涉及日期时,MONTH、YEAR等函数返回的是数值,比较时无需加引号,如(MONTH(A2:A11)=5)即筛选5月数据。
三、从练习到熟练的进阶建议
每天选取一个真实报表片段(如销售日报、考勤汇总),用SUMPRODUCT替代传统SUMIF或嵌套IF实现同类计算,记录公式修改前后的时间成本;重点掌握“逻辑数组×数值数组”的思维转换,理解每个括号内表达式最终生成的是由0和1组成的虚拟数组;结合WPS或Excel内置的“公式求值”功能,逐步查看公式的每一步运算结果,强化对布尔值强制转换过程的感知;完成5个不同场景(单条件求和、多条件计数、月份汇总、模糊匹配、跨列加权)的独立练习后,可自然过渡至SUMIFS对比学习,体会二者在可读性与兼容性上的互补关系。
综上,SUMPRODUCT以低门槛承载高实用性,是新手打通函数思维的关键支点。
优惠推荐

- 唯卓仕85mm F1.8 Z/X/FE卡口微单相机中远摄人像定焦自动对焦镜头
优惠前¥2229
¥1729优惠后

- Sony/索尼 Alpha 7R V A7RM5新一代全画幅微单双影像画质旗舰相机
优惠前¥27998
¥22499优惠后


